Men's Volleyball Topped by Kean

MADISON, N.J. - The Drew University men's volleyball team took on Kean University in its second home match in team history Wednesday evening in Baldwin Gym. But despite making a season-high seven blocks, the Rangers came up on the short end of a 3-0 decision. 

The Cougars (6-4) prevailed by scores of 25-19, 25-23, and 25-13.

Sophomore Omarf Ortega-Reyes led Drew (3-9) with 12 kills, six digs, three blocks (one solo), and two aces. Freshman Jacob Sledz contributed eight kills and seven digs while classmate Ephraim Smith tallied six kills. Freshman C.J. Addeo and junior Furat Alhayek threw down three blocks apiece, including a solo stuff for Alhayek. Freshman Huriel Perez dished out 27 assists.

Duncan Beilke posted 10 kills, six digs, and four blocks for Kean.

The Cougars jumped to a 6-2 lead in the opener and gradually pulled away. In the second set, it was the Rangers who had the quick start, opening on a 4-1 spurt. Kean would eventually take the lead; however, it remained close the rest of the way. It was tied 16-16, and the Cougars led just 23-22 before scoring two of the last three points to assume a 2-0 lead. 

The visitors took control early in the third set, when it started on a 9-2 run.

The Rangers take a week off before hosting Sage College next Tuesday at 7 p.m.
